Hey, Young And The Restless fans. We’ve got some pretty big and shocking casting news for you guys. It turns out that there’s been a major switch-up over on the Young And The Restless set. According to the folks over at Soapcentral.com and Daytime Confidential, actress Michelle Stafford is indeed about to reprise her role of Phyllis Summers after leaving it way, way back in 2014! Unfortunately, this means that poor Gina Tognoni is out of a job over there.

The Young And The Restless producers had no shame in getting rid of Gina for Michelle. In fact, they facilitated the whole thing! Soapcentral.com said that the Young And The Restless producers actually lured Michelle Stafford back to her former Young And The Restless role as soon as they found out that she was out over at General Hospital.

Soapcentral provided a little back story about this whole situation. Back in 2014, Michelle Stafford left her Young And The Restless, Phyllis Summers role to go play an original character named Nina Reeves on ABC’s General Hospital. However, as of recent, the contract talks between Michelle Stafford and General Hospital didn’t work out.

It was reported that the negotiations went down to the wire. But in the end, they just couldn’t make it happen. It’s unclear if Michelle wanted more money or what. What is clear is that somebody didn’t get what they wanted out of the deal. This caused Michelle to be a free agent, and the Young And The Restless producers immediately jumped at the chance to get Michelle back to reprise the Phyllis Summers role!

Apparently, Young And The Restless came up with a good enough offer for Michelle to agree to come back and reprise the Phyllis Summers role. This, of course, left poor Gina Tognoni out of a job after she had been playing the Phyllis Summers role since 2014. She had also won a daytime Emmy award back in 2017 for “Outstanding Lead Actress.”

Despite being seemingly kicked out of her role as Phyllis, Gina posted a very nice Instagram post about her experience of working on the Young And The Restless set. She wrote, “Five years ago, I was blessed to embrace the incredible character of Phyllis Summers Abbott. I am beyond grateful for the creative experience that The Young And The Restless has given to me as well as the amazing relationships I made with the cast, crew/staff, producers, and writers. I love my Genoa City family, which made it easy to give 110% everyday. My long commutes always went smoothly because I loved where I worked and the people I worked with!

My thanks to Sony Pictures Television and CBS and a special thank you to the Y&R viewers for their love and support. I wish Y&R continued success and everything it richly deserves. You guys can view that post over on Gina’s official Instagram account by Clicking Here.
